Class 12 menstrual cycle worksheets available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ive coverage of the complex hormonal and physiological processes that regulate the female reproductive system. These expertly designed resources strengthen students' understanding of the intricate feedback mechanisms involving the hypothalamus, pituitary gland, and ovaries, while building proficiency in analyzing hormone level fluctuations throughout the follicular and luteal phases. The worksheets feature detailed practice problems that challenge students to interpret graphs of estrogen and progesterone levels, identify the timing of ovulation, and explain the relationship between hormonal changes and endometrial development. Each resource includes a complete answer key and is available as a free printable pdf, making it easy for educators to assess student comprehension of this essential human biology concept.
